Output 90434e8cc64b7453588f08ebebf305113e693c738dce7d18615fc952248aec94:0

value
855195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54fe2776eaac27a0c8bb3bffb66028ee51ad3394 OP_EQUALVERIFY OP_CHECKSIG
address
18kQE49WeQJt7ow4rMUTZDtAyMXRn77P2c
transaction
90434e8cc64b7453588f08ebebf305113e693c738dce7d18615fc952248aec94
spent
true